About the Role
The engineer will diagnose issues, perform repairs, and provide on-site service for customer equipment while following safety and quality standards.
Responsibilities
- Install and configure systems at customer sites
- Perform scheduled and emergency maintenance
- Troubleshoot technical malfunctions efficiently
- Repair or replace defective components
- Ensure equipment meets operational standards
- Document service activities and outcomes
- Follow safety protocols during field operations
- Respond to customer service requests promptly
- Calibrate instruments according to specifications
- Maintain accurate service records
- Communicate technical details to non-technical staff
- Coordinate with internal teams for support
- Adhere to quality assurance procedures
- Use diagnostic tools to identify issues
- Provide on-site training to customers
- Follow up on unresolved service issues
- Work independently in field environments
- Meet response time targets for service calls
- Support product upgrades and retrofits
- Ensure compliance with regulatory standards
- Minimize equipment downtime for clients
- Escalate complex issues when necessary
- Maintain company-owned service vehicles
- Stock and manage spare parts inventory
- Report field data for performance analysis
